Cracker barrel is my favorite place to eat and we don't have any near where I live so during my 14 hour drive I stopped here to eat with my children. My kids got chocolate chip pancakes and I got the strawberry cheesecake stuffed pancakes which we all normally love but these were cooked weird. Our pancakes were super greasy and crunchy for some reason. I asked about it since I'd never had greasy pancakes before. She told me they were just cooked in butter....ok...I tried them and they were super savory tasting (I think they cooked the pancakes in the bacon grease personally). Imagine a savory crunchy hushpuppy but covered in cool whip strawberries and syrup. Yes, those were awful pancakes. I tasted 1 bite and couldn't force myself to eat anymore. My 1 year old who eats everything also wouldn't eat his food. My 4 year old managed to eat about 1/3 of one pancake. The manager said he'd take the pancakes off the bill which was nice but once we got to the cash register he'd only taken the chocolate chip ones off. Then the cashier kept telling me "he took off the chocolate chip ones see?!" I told her that I think he meant to take them both off as that's what he told me. She didn't seem to believe me and I felt like she was annoyed I'd even asked about it. She asked for a manager and finally one showed up... that person also kept saying "he took off one of your pancakes" which I just didn't respond to. I offered to just pay the bill because I was embarrassed standing at the cash register while other people were trying to check out and leave but they said they'd sort it out. Finally he showed up and apologized saying that it was his fault, that he thought he took them both off. They charged me for the eggs and bacon instead. I ended up paying about $23 for 3 drinks and a couple eggs and a slice of bacon. :' ) I was already so embarrassed by the whole ordeal that I didn't even bother to ask for them to scan my rewards. I do highly recommend cracker barrel, it's normally very delicious and friendly but I wouldn't recommend this specific one, I'd say keep driving until you get to...

Arrived and seated no problem, server came fairly quickly for drink orders and since we were ready we gave our meal orders. I opened my wrapped silverware to find crusted food on the fork missed in the wash. Rather than wait for our server I got 2 more flatware wraps from the station. To my dismay both had food residue on the forks. The cornbread and biscuits didn’t come until the food came, only there were no biscuits. They were still cooking. I brought my dirty flatware to our server’s attention - she assured me she would tend to clean ones personally. I waited... and waited. She came back to see how we were doing and realized she forgot my silverware. I waited some more. She finally returned with clean silver, but by now about 15 minutes had passed since our food arrived, so my meal was hardly still warm, and my companions were nearly finished. Nothing like eating a room temperature meal. The biscuits finally came and were hot and fresh - but would have been nice at the beginning. The restaurant was active but certainly not crowded, so I don’t understand why they couldn’t keep up the supply of biscuits. Our server never came to ask for drink refills, dropped the check before we were finished, and didn’t bother asking if we wanted anything else. After the check hit the table we didn’t see her again.

It was New Years Day so I still gave her 20%, but it was not without some hesitation. And this is not the first sub-standard experience I’ve had at a Crackerbarrel. I used to enjoy them. I chalk this up to poor management and staff training. Not sure I’ll be visiting another one...

Cracker Barrel Review - 12/06/2024

Stopped in after enjoying the drive-through lights in Doswell, VA, on the way home. We were seated quickly and greeted promptly by our server, who took our drink orders and meals at the same time—a nice touch for efficiency.

I opted for the fried chicken tenders with mac and cheese and steak fries. The meal was absolutely delicious, though the chicken was slightly dry. However, the buttermilk ranch served on the side was phenomenal—easily some of the best restaurant ranch I've had in a long time and it elevated the dish significantly. The biscuits, clearly made in-house, were a delightful complement to the meal.

One person at my table had the grilled chicken tenders, steak fries, and chicken and dumplings. Everything was equally delicious, though they jokingly remarked that the portion of chicken wasn’t enough to satisfy their craving! Another in our group had the Hamburger Steak with gravy, paired with fried sweet apples. The dish was fantastic overall, though the mashed potatoes left something to be desired. They were hard and seemed like they might have been sitting for a while, which was a slight letdown.

We also enjoyed the charm of the country store, with its variety of nostalgic candies, old-fashioned treats, and unique clothing options. It added a quaint and inviting touch to the overall experience.

All in all, a wonderful meal and atmosphere to look forward to revisiting. Despite a couple of minor critiques, the quality of the food and the overall visit make this a stop worth...

First off, I’m sorry I can’t remember her name but our server and the store were the best part of this restaurant. The appetizers were pretty good as well. I personally would only recommend getting breakfast food/pancakes from here because everything else was terrible besides the chicken tenders and steak. My grits tasted like they were cooked in tap water, I tried adding butter and sugar to it but it just had this weird after taste no matter what and was watery. Eggs were basic eggs, bacon was tasteless and over cooked and the apples were just nasty. The okra wasn’t seasoned and tasted over cooked as well and the mashed potatoes.. idk what was happening. I know you see the corn bread muffin and biscuit in the background as well and they were hard and dry too. And as I mentioned the store, although cluttered and hard to maneuver through certain parts was the best part. Did it make up for the terrible meal? No. But the butter beer was amazing.

Came back after a small trip and stopped by for some dinner. My girlfriend ordered the steak (medium) and shrimp with corn and dumplin's, and I ordered the trout with dumplin's and rice. It all started out alright, got seated, and got drinks. We asked for some biscuits and jam to start off before our meal. We were given 3 rock-hard biscuits that were very hard to eat with the jam. Then our entres came out. The shrimp was completely neglected in the order. And the steak was cooked wrong. There were hard gristle spots all over the cut. When complained about the shrimp, we received extremely overcooked pieces. The rice we received was crunchy and barely cooked. We were not pleased with the experience.
